Minnesota Democratic U.S. Senate candidate Walter Mondale stops to greet Maria Mohamed, 4-1/2 months, and her mother Amy during a stroll through the skyway in Minneapolis Thursday, Oct. 31, 2002. Mondale, who replaced the late Sen. Paul Wellstone on the ticket, touted his experience Thursday while Republican Norm Coleman emphasized his youth. (AP photo/Janet Hostetter)
